Assane Dioussé El Hadji (born 20 September 1997) is a Senegalese footballer who plays as a defensive midfielder for French Ligue 1 club Saint-Étienne.[1]

Club career

Empoli

Dioussé is a youth product from Empoli. He made his Serie A debut on 23 August 2015 against Chievo Verona.[2]

Saint-Étienne

On 31 July 2017 Assane Dioussé signed his new contract with Saint-Étienne. [3]

International career

Dioussé debuted for the Senegal U20s in a Under-20 Four Nations Tournament 3-0 loss to France U20s on 23 March 2017.[4]
